How Does the Stack System Speed Training App Actually Work?
The Stack System uses advanced motion capture technology integrated into your smartphone to record and analyze your golf swing. When you initiate a training session, the app’s camera tracks your club and body movement frame-by-frame. The proprietary algorithm measures club head speed, attack angle, swing plane, and dozens of other biomechanical variables. Within seconds of completing your swing, you receive detailed metrics and visual feedback showing exactly what happened during your motion.

Setup is remarkably simple. Position your phone at the proper angle—typically behind the ball or to the side—and begin recording your swings. The app automatically detects the golf swing and begins analysis. No additional sensors, wearables, or expensive hardware required.

What Practical Steps Should You Take to Maximize the Stack System Speed Training App?
Getting started with the Stack System requires more than simply downloading the app. A structured approach to training yields the best results. Begin by establishing baseline measurements of your current club head speed, attack angle, and swing plane. These baseline metrics become your reference point for tracking progress and setting realistic improvement goals.

Dedicate specific practice sessions to speed training rather than mixing it with casual range practice. Focused training sessions produce better results than sporadic data collection. Aim for 2-3 structured sessions weekly, with each session lasting 20-30 minutes. Consistency matters more than intensity in developing lasting improvements.
Step-by-Step Guide to Stack System Training Success
- Week 1: Establish baseline metrics across all club types in your bag.
- Week 2-3: Focus on driver speed optimization using the app’s guided training modules.
- Week 4-6: Expand training to fairway woods and long irons while maintaining driver consistency.
- Week 7-8: Incorporate mid-iron and short-iron training to build comprehensive speed development.
- Ongoing: Use the app’s progress dashboard to identify areas needing additional focus.
Combine the Stack System with complementary training methods for optimal results. Strength and conditioning exercises targeting rotational power significantly enhance speed development. Flexibility work, particularly in the thoracic spine and hip flexors, improves your ability to generate efficient club head speed. The Stack System measures your improvements; targeted physical training creates the foundation for those improvements.
Consider pairing the Stack System with pressure plate analysis for comprehensive biomechanical insights. Pressure plate weight shift analysis reveals how your lower body generates power, complementing the Stack System’s upper body and club path metrics. Together, these tools create a complete picture of your swing mechanics and improvement trajectory.
